Speed Calculator
Adjust the options below to see how much broadband speed your household needs.
HD uses ~5 Mbps per person. 4K uses ~25 Mbps.
Each person on calls needs around 10 Mbps.
Competitive gaming needs low latency as much as raw speed.
Cameras, thermostats, speakers and similar devices each use a few Mbps.

A note on broadband providers. Ofcom data shows what's available. Not which provider to pick. Actual speeds depend on your line, your router, and your provider. Check BT, Sky, Virgin Media, and local FTTP operators. Compare deals at broadbandcompareuk.com or uSwitch. Contract lengths vary. 18 months is standard. Some offer 12. Ask about setup fees. They range from free to £50+. Run a speed test after installation. If speeds don't match what you're paying for, complain.
